1.Oval Tunnel Shows Better Rotational Stability Than Round Tunnel in Anatomical Single-Bundle Anterior Cruciate Ligament Reconstruction:Biomechanical Study in a Porcine Model
Seong Hwan KIM ; Kyu-Tae KANG ; Han-Jun LEE ; Deokjae HEO ; Kyunghwan CHA ; Sangmin LEE ; Yong-Beom PARK
Clinics in Orthopedic Surgery 2024;16(6):925-931
		                        		
		                        			 Background:
		                        			To compare knee laxity between the conventional round tunnel and oval tunnel techniques in primary anterior cruciate ligament (ACL) reconstruction in a porcine knee model. 
		                        		
		                        			Methods:
		                        			Twenty porcine knees were used for evaluating laxity in terms of anterior translation and anterolateral rotation. The study determined porcine knee kinematics on the Instron instruments under simulated Lachman (89 N anterior tibial load) at 15°, 30°, and 60° of flexion and a simulated pivot shift test (89 N anterior tibial load, 10 Nm valgus, and 4 Nm internal tibial torque) at 30° of flexion. Kinematics were recorded for intact (n = 10), ACL-deficient (n = 10), and conventional round (n = 10) or oval tunnel (n = 10) techniques. All measurements were repeated twice, and the average was used for comparison. 
		                        		
		                        			Results:
		                        			Under the Lachman test, the conventional round tunnel and oval tunnel both showed significantly larger anterior tibial translation (ATT) at 30° and 60° compared to the intact knee (p < 0.05), but smaller ATT compared to the ACL-deficient knees (p < 0.05). However, there were no differences in ATT between the conventional round tunnel and oval tunnel techniques (p > 0.05). Under simulated pivot shift at 30° flexion, there was a significant difference between the conventional round tunnel and oval tunnel techniques (round vs. oval: 4.27 ± 0.87 mm vs. 3.52 ± 0.49 mm, p = 0.028). 
		                        		
		                        			Conclusions
		                        			Both conventional round tunnel and oval tunnel techniques reduced ATT compared to ACL-deficient knees but failed to restore normal knee stability. However, the oval tunnel technique showed better rotational stability at 30° than the round tunnel technique. These findings suggest that the oval tunnel technique would be a reasonable option in anatomical single-bundle ACL reconstruction.

5.Bronchoesophageal fistula in a patient with Crohn’s disease receiving anti-tumor necrosis factor therapy
Kyunghwan OH ; Kee Don CHOI ; Hyeong Ryul KIM ; Tae Sun SHIM ; Byong Duk YE ; Suk-Kyun YANG ; Sang Hyoung PARK
Clinical Endoscopy 2023;56(2):239-244
		                        		
		                        			
		                        			 Tuberculosis is an adverse event in patients with Crohn’s disease receiving anti-tumor necrosis factor (TNF) therapy. However, tuberculosis presenting as a bronchoesophageal fistula (BEF) is rare. We report a case of tuberculosis and BEF in a patient with Crohn’s disease who received anti-TNF therapy. A 33-year-old Korean woman developed fever and cough 2 months after initiation of anti-TNF therapy. And the symptoms persisted for 1 months, so she visited the emergency room. Chest computed tomography was performed upon visiting the emergency room, which showed BEF with aspiration pneumonia. Esophagogastroduodenoscopy with biopsy and endobronchial ultrasound with transbronchial needle aspiration confirmed that the cause of BEF was tuberculosis. Anti-tuberculosis medications were administered, and esophageal stent insertion through endoscopy was performed to manage the BEF. However, the patient’s condition did not improve; therefore, fistulectomy with primary closure was performed. After fistulectomy, the anastomosis site healing was delayed due to severe inflammation, a second esophageal stent and gastrostomy tube were inserted. Nine months after the diagnosis, the fistula disappeared without recurrence, and the esophageal stent and gastrostomy tube were removed.

7.Real-world effectiveness and safety of ustekinumab induction therapy for Korean patients with Crohn’s disease: a KASID prospective multicenter study
Kyunghwan OH ; Hee Seung HONG ; Nam Seok HAM ; Jungbok LEE ; Sang Hyoung PARK ; Suk-Kyun YANG ; Hyuk YOON ; You Sun KIM ; Chang Hwan CHOI ; Byong Duk YE ;
Intestinal Research 2023;21(1):137-147
		                        		
		                        			 Background/Aims:
		                        			We investigated the real-world effectiveness and safety of ustekinumab (UST) as induction treatment for Koreans with Crohn’s disease (CD). 
		                        		
		                        			Methods:
		                        			CD patients who started UST were prospectively enrolled from 4 hospitals in Korea. All enrolled patients received intravenous UST infusion at week 0 and subcutaneous UST injection at week 8. Clinical outcomes were assessed using Crohn’s Disease Activity Index (CDAI) scores at weeks 8 and 20 among patients with active disease (CDAI ≥150) at baseline. Clinical remission was defined as a CDAI <150, and clinical response was defined as a reduction in CDAI ≥70 points from baseline. Safety and factors associated with clinical remission at week 20 were also analyzed. 
		                        		
		                        			Results:
		                        			Sixty-five patients were enrolled between January 2019 and December 2020. Among 49 patients with active disease at baseline (CDAI ≥150), clinical remission and clinical response at week 8 were achieved in 26 (53.1%) and 30 (61.2%) patients, respectively. At week 20, 27 (55.1%) and 35 (71.4%) patients achieved clinical remission and clinical response, respectively. Twenty-seven patients (41.5%) experienced adverse events, with serious adverse events in 3 patients (4.6%). One patient (1.5%) stopped UST therapy due to poor response. Underweight (body mass index <18.5 kg/m2) (odds ratio [OR], 0.085; 95% confidence interval [CI], 0.014–0.498; P=0.006) and elevated C-reactive protein at baseline (OR, 0.133; 95% CI, 0.022–0.823; P=0.030) were inversely associated with clinical remission at week 20. 
		                        		
		                        			Conclusions
		                        			UST was effective and well-tolerated as induction therapy for Korean patients with CD. 
		                        		
		                        		
		                        		
		                        	
8.Oral beclomethasone dipropionate as an add-on therapy and response prediction in Korean patients with ulcerative colitis
Kyuwon KIM ; Hee Seung HONG ; Kyunghwan OH ; Jae Yong LEE ; Seung Wook HONG ; Jin Hwa PARK ; Sung Wook HWANG ; Dong-Hoon YANG ; Jeong-Sik BYEON ; Seung-Jae MYUNG ; Suk-Kyun YANG ; Byong Duk YE ; Sang Hyoung PARK
The Korean Journal of Internal Medicine 2022;37(6):1140-1152
		                        		
		                        			 Background/Aims:
		                        			We aimed to investigate the oral beclomethasone dipropionate’s (BDP) efficacy as an add-on therapy and to clarify the predictive factor for response to oral BDP in Korean ulcerative colitis (UC) patients. 
		                        		
		                        			Methods:
		                        			Patients with a stable concomitant drug regimen with exposure to oral BDP (5 mg/day) within 30 days before BDP initiation were included. Partial Mayo score (pMS) was used to evaluate response to oral BDP. Clinical remission (CREM) was defined as a post-treatment pMS ≤ 1 point. Clinical response (CRES) was defined as an at least 2-point decrease in post-treatment pMS and an at least 30% decrease from baseline pMS. Patients without CREM or CRES were considered nonresponders (NRs). 
		                        		
		                        			Results:
		                        			Of all, 37 showed CREM, 19 showed CRES, and 44 were NRs. The CREM group included more patients with mild disease activity (75.7% vs. 43.2%, p = 0.011) than NRs. In contrast to NRs, CREM and CRES patients showed significant improvement of post-treatment erythrocyte sedimentation rate (ESR) and C-reactive protein (CRP) (ESR with p = 0.001, CRP with p = 0.004, respectively). Moreover, the initial rectal bleeding subscore (RBS) was significantly different between CREM and CRES, or NR (both with p < 0.001). In multivariate analyses, initial stool frequency subscore (SFS) of 0 and RBS of 0 were predictive factors for CREM (odds ratio [OR], 15.359; 95% confidence interval [CI], 1.085 to 217.499; p = 0.043 for SFS, and OR, 11.434; 95% CI, 1.682 to 77.710; p = 0.013 for RBS). 
		                        		
		                        			Conclusions
		                        			Oral BDP is an efficacious add-on therapy in Korean UC patients. Patients with initial SFS or RBS of 0 may be particularly good candidates for oral BDP. 
		                        		
		                        		
		                        		
		                        	
9.Medication Adherence in Korean Patients with Inflammatory Bowel Disease and Its Associated Factors
Kyunghwan OH ; Eun Ja KWON ; Jeong Hye KIM ; Kyuwon KIM ; Jae Yong LEE ; Hee Seung HONG ; Seung Wook HONG ; Jin Hwa PARK ; Sung Wook HWANG ; Dong-Hoon YANG ; Byong Duk YE ; Jeong-Sik BYEON ; Seung-Jae MYUNG ; Suk-Kyun YANG ; Jeong Yun PARK ; Sang Hyoung PARK
The Ewha Medical Journal 2022;45(2):35-45
		                        		
		                        			 Objectives:
		                        			It is important that inflammatory bowel disease (IBD) patients adhere to their prescribed medication regimens to avoid the repeat exacerbations, complications, or surgeries associated with this disorder. However, there are few studies on medication adherence in patients with IBD, especially in Asian populations. So, we analyzed the factors associated with medication adherence in Korean IBD patients. 
		                        		
		                        			Methods:
		                        			Patients who had been diagnosed with Crohn’s disease (CD) or ulcerative colitis (UC) more than 6 months previously and receiving oral medications for IBD were enrolled. Medication adherence was measured using the Medical Adherence Reporting Scale (MARS-5), a self-reported medication adherence measurement tool. 
		                        		
		                        			Results:
		                        			Among 207 patients in the final study population, 125 (60.4%) had CD and 134 (64.7%) were men. The mean age was 39.63 years (SD, 13.16 years) and the mean disease duration was 10.09 years (SD, 6.33 years). The mean medication adherence score was 22.46 (SD, 2.86) out of 25, and 181 (87.4%) patients had score of 20 or higher.In multiple linear regression analysis, self-efficacy (β=0.341, P<0.001) and ≥3 dosing per day (β=–0.192 P=0.016) were revealed to be significant factors associated with medication adherence. Additionally, there was a positive correlation between self-efficacy and medication adherence (r=0.312, P<0.001). However, disease related knowledge, depression, and anxiety were not significantly associated with medication adherence. 
		                        		
		                        			Conclusion
		                        			To improve medication adherence among patients with IBD, a reduction in the number of doses per day and an improved self-efficacy will be helpful. 
		                        		
		                        		
		                        		
		                        	
10.Vertebral Osteomyelitis Caused by Mucormycosis.
Kyunghwan OH ; Oh Chan KWON ; Hyung Jun PARK ; Mingee LEE ; Sang Cheol CHO ; Joon Seon SONG ; Sung Han KIM
Korean Journal of Medicine 2017;92(1):84-88
		                        		
		                        			
		                        			Mucormycosis is a rare but fatal disease and usually affects the rhinocerebrum, lungs, traumatic wounds or surgical sites. Vertebral osteomyelitis due to mucormycosis is very rare, with only three cases caused by mucormycosis since 1970 being reported, and none in Korea. Here, we present a case of vertebral osteomyelitis caused by mucormycosis in a 67-year-old woman, having type 2 diabetes mellitus for 10 years, who was in complete remission from acute leukemia after chemotherapy 3 years previously.
